Sans Superellipse Unde 1 is a very bold, wide, low contrast, upright, normal x-height font.

A heavy, squared-round sans with superellipse geometry and a distinctly modular construction. Strokes are thick and consistent, corners are broadly rounded, and counters tend toward squared apertures that echo the outer shapes. Terminals are mostly flat and horizontal/vertical, with occasional angled joins in diagonals (notably in K, V, W, X, Y, Z) that keep the forms crisp rather than soft. The rhythm is wide-set and blocky, with compact internal spaces and a strong, even color that reads clearly in all-caps and mixed-case settings.

This font performs best in short, prominent text such as headlines, brand marks, titles, and poster typography where its chunky, geometric silhouettes can dominate the page. It also suits packaging and apparel graphics, esports or sports branding, and interface/game UI elements where a futuristic, industrial flavor is desired. For longer passages, it’s most effective at larger sizes with generous spacing to preserve counter clarity.

The overall tone feels engineered and display-forward, with a retro-digital and arcade-like confidence. Its rounded-rectangle shapes suggest technology and machinery, while the heavy massing gives it a bold, commanding presence suitable for energetic, high-impact messaging.

The design appears intended to deliver a distinctive, tech-leaning display voice built from rounded-rectangle primitives, prioritizing impact, consistency, and a strong geometric identity. It aims for immediate recognizability through modular shapes, tight counters, and a uniform, machine-made finish.

Uppercase forms are especially geometric and rectangular, while lowercase introduces simplified, single-storey structures (a, g) that maintain the same squared-round logic. Numerals follow the same modular system, with squared counters and sturdy silhouettes that favor clarity and punch over delicacy.
